Certified Tour Guide for Berlin and Potsdam Licensed to show: Cecilienhof Palace, Charlottenburg Palace (new wing) and Park, Bildergalerie Park Sanssouci, Potsdam Schönhausen Palace, Grunewald Jagdschloss (Hunting Palace) Germany does not allow tour guides to drive hired cars or minivans. This service must be given by two persons. A hired car always has a driver.

Your day begins right at your cruise ship, where my driver and I will meet you depending on the time you give us. Then we head out on a scenic 2.5-hour drive through northeastern Germany. I’ll share stories that bring this region to life—so you’ll already feel connected before we even reach Berlin. In the city, we’ll explore a rich mix of landmarks and neighborhoods: • Brandenburg Gate • Holocaust Memorial • Reichstag • Checkpoint Charlie • Berlin Wall • Gendarmenmarkt • Museum Island • Unter den Linden • Bebelplatz • Kreuzberg • Prenzlauer Berg • Kurfürstendamm • Kaiser Wilhelm Memorial Church • Charlottenburg Palace • Olympic Stadium • Grunewald After a full day, we return to the port on time.
